Using mini 360 step down to power INFRAFED ILLUMINATOR 5mm, 940mn LED

Can i use mini 360 stepdown voltage to power Infrared LED 5 mm, 940mn. I will use 5 pcs on parallel. The supply voltage for mini 360 is 5v from smartphone charger and i will set on required voltage needed of ir led.

I will use it for my ESP32-CAM no ir filter already for nightvision

Here the actual photo of the item.

  • Module property: Non-isolation buck
  • Rectification mode: Non-synchronous rectifier
  • Input voltage: 3.6 V - 46 V
  • Output voltage: 1.25 V - 35 V
  • Output current: Rated current is 3 A,
  • Conversion efficiency: 92% (highest)
  • Switching frequency: 65 kHz
  • Output ripple: 30 mV (maximum)
  • Load regulation: ±0.5%
  • Voltage regulation: ±2.5%
  • Work temperature: -40° - 85°
